Correlation energy of an electron gas: An experimental approach

Description
The photothreshold of ferromagnetically ordered, 2-at.%-La-doped (i.e., metallic) EuO is approx. 0.5 eV lower at 10 K than in the paramagnetic state. The difference between the correlation and exchange energy of the conduction electrons, which are unpolarized at T > T/sub c/ and fully polarized at T very-much-less-than T/sub c/, directly accounts for the shift of the threshold
